Hi all,

I noticed a small clicking noise coming from the exhaust when I turn the engine off on my petrol 2012 C180 coupe. It lasts only for a couple of minutes.
Does anyone know what could be the cause?

It depends how hot they get based on how you drive and the ambient temperature outside.

The hotter they get, the more noise they will make as they cool.

If you start the car for 10 seconds (from cold obviously) and turn off, you should hear nothing.

It's much more noticeable on some cars than others; I've only ever been aware of it on two of my cars over many years even though all are driven in much the same way and I always suspected that it was a section of flexi-joint that was the main culprit. It's certainly not anything to be concerned about. It might also depend on how the joints are aligned and how tight the bolts are).
